| /// @assertion E firstWhere(bool test(E element), {Object orElse()}) |
| /// ... |
| /// If none matches, the result of invoking the orElse function is returned. |
| /// @description Checks that the [orElse] function is invoked and its result is |
| /// returned if no element matches [test]. |
| /// @author msyabro |
| |
| |
| import "dart:typed_data"; |
| import "../../../Utils/expect.dart"; |
| |
| main() { |
| var count = 0; |
| int f() { |
| count++; |
| return 1; |
| } |
| var l = new Int16List.fromList([1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 9]); |
| var res = l.firstWhere((element) => false, orElse: f); |
| Expect.equals(1, count); |
| Expect.equals(1, res); |
| |
| res = l.firstWhere((element) => element > 100, orElse: f); |
| Expect.equals(2, count); |
| Expect.equals(1, res); |
| |
| l = new Int16List.fromList([]); |
| res = l.firstWhere((element) => true, orElse: f); |
| Expect.equals(3, count); |
| Expect.equals(1, res); |
| } |
